How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Actually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to restore your laminate floor to its original condition. We understand the importance of proper techniques and equipment to ensure a successful restoration. When corners are cut, the risk of further damage and costly repairs increases. Our technicians are trained to handle every aspect of laminate floor water damage restoration, from assessment to completion.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our technicians arrive on-site to assess the damage and contain the affected area.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a safe working environment.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and prevent it from spreading to other areas of your home. Within 60 minutes, our team will have the area contained and ready for the next step.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use powerful extractors to remove standing water from your laminate floor. Our technicians are trained to use the right equipment for the job, ensuring that your floor is completely dry before restoration begins.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team uses advanced drying equipment to quickly dry your laminate floor. We also employ dehumidification techniques to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ring that your floor is completely dry before restoration begins. This step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Demolition and Restoration

Once your laminate floor is dry, our technicians will begin the demolition process. We remove the damaged flooring and underlying materials, preparing the area for restoration. Our team then installs new laminate flooring, ensuring a seamless transition from the damaged area.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Our technicians conduct a final inspection to ensure that your laminate floor is completely restored to its original condition. We also clean up any debris and materials removed during the restoration process, leaving your home looking like new.

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ration

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Our team is here to help you identify the warning signs of laminate floor water damage and provide a prompt solution to restore your floor to its original condition.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ty smell in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ture. If you notice a strong, unpleasant odor coming from your laminate floor,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can detect hidden moisture and provide a solution to remove the odor and pr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led laminate flooring is a clear sign of water damage. If you notice your flooring is uneven or has visible signs of damage,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Our team can assess the damage and provide a solution to restore your flooring to its original condition.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your laminate floor can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ual stains or discoloration,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can detect hidden moisture and provide a solution to restore your flooring to its original condition.

Peeling or Cracking Laminate Flooring

Peeling or cracking laminate fl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your flooring is peeling or cracking,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Our team can assess the damage and provide a solution to restore your flooring to its original condition.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ew on your laminate floor can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ual growth or discoloration,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can detect hidden moisture and provide a solution to remove the mold and prevent further damage.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on laminate floor Yes No DIY cleanup is usually enough for small spills.
Water damage affecting a large area of laminate flooring No Yes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age.
Hidden moisture detected in laminate floor No Yes Professionals can detect hidden moisture and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Musty odors persisting after cleanup No Yes Professionals can detect the source of the odor and provide a solution to remove it.
Warped or buckled laminate flooring No Yes Professionals can assess the damage and provide a solution to restore the flooring to its original condition.
Vis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Professionals can detect the source of the mold and provide a solution to remove it.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Valparaiso, NE

The cost of laminate floor water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Valparaiso, NE. These estimates are based on average prices and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Laminate floor demolition and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of laminate flooring
Moisture detection and remediation $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Containment and c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Final inspection and warranty $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of laminate flooring
Free estimate and consultation $0 – $100 Size of affected area, type of laminate flooring
